Address

a8bEESAHmLNrFpm7vswyHCZCkLqz5PvqLvCopy

Total Received

50.60472863 FIRO

Total Sent

50.60472863 FIRO

№ Transactions

694

Final Balance

0 FIRO

Transactions
Filter